Contents:
In the Security Council we trust -- There's a new sheriff in town -- Don't ask me, I just work here -- The terrorists' club -- You can't fight city hall (or global government) -- Pistols, palaces, and petroleum -- Trick or treaty -- It's party time, UN style -- With friends like these.
